High-Velocity Fan offers max air throw of 160 ft.

January 6, 2010 - Employing hybrid fan technology, model H26B is 26 in. high-velocity fan suitable for continuous operation in industrial/warehouse environments. It comes with 230/460 V, 3-phase overload protection motor; draws 1.8 A; and has rated air throw of up to 160 ft. Rated to 7,560 cfm, fan has baked-on powder coated finish as well as yoke mount that facilitates installation.

Patterson's 26 Inch Fan Proves to Be an Excellent Addition to Fan Line


Vance Patterson, Owner, President and CEO of Patterson Fan Company, Inc initiated the successful plan to add a 26" high velocity fan to Patterson Fan's line. The new 26" fan is perfect for customer's who need 160 feet of high performance air flow.

Blythewood, SC --New, Patterson's 26" high velocity fan, with hybrid fan technology, is suitable for continuous operation in industrial/warehouse environments. The 26" unit comes standard with; 230/460V 3 phase overload protection motor, a low amp draw of 1.8 amps,7,560 CFM, yoke mount for easy installation and baked on powder coated finish. Patterson's 26 inch fan has an impressive air throw of up to 160 feet. Model number: H26B.

Vance Patterson, Owner, President and CEO of Patterson Fan Company, Inc initiated the plan to add a 26" high velocity fan to Patterson's line of quality air moving products. Mark Moore, Chief Engineer of Patterson Fan, was responsible for the fan's design and performance. The design-to-build process took almost 3 months and has proven to be an excellent addition to the Patterson Fan line. The 26" fan is perfect for customer's who need more air throw than Patterson's 22" fan at 120' and not as much as Patterson's powerful 30" fan with a 200' air throw.

Expect Patterson Fan quality - built tough for years of use. New 26" Patterson high velocity fans are proudly manufactured in the USA.
